What are the main differences between Black pepper and Sunflower seed?

  • Black pepper is richer in Manganese, Vitamin K, Fiber, and Iron, yet Sunflower seed is richer in Vitamin E , Vitamin B1, Selenium, Vitamin B6, Phosphorus, and Folate.
  • Black pepper's daily need coverage for Manganese is 470% higher.

We used Spices, pepper, black and Seeds, sunflower seed kernels, dried types in this comparison.

All nutrients comparison - raw data values

Nutrient Black pepper Sunflower seed Opinion
Net carbs 38.65g 11.4g Black pepper
Protein 10.39g 20.78g Sunflower seed
Fats 3.26g 51.46g Sunflower seed
Carbs 63.95g 20g Black pepper
Calories 251kcal 584kcal Sunflower seed
Fructose 0.23g Black pepper
Sugar 0.64g 2.62g Black pepper
Fiber 25.3g 8.6g Black pepper
Calcium 443mg 78mg Black pepper
Iron 9.71mg 5.25mg Black pepper
Magnesium 171mg 325mg Sunflower seed
Phosphorus 158mg 660mg Sunflower seed
Potassium 1329mg 645mg Black pepper
Sodium 20mg 9mg Sunflower seed
Zinc 1.19mg 5mg Sunflower seed
Copper 1.33mg 1.8mg Sunflower seed
Manganese 12.753mg 1.95mg Black pepper
Selenium 4.9µg 53µg Sunflower seed
Vitamin A 547IU 50IU Black pepper
Vitamin A RAE 27µg 3µg Black pepper
Vitamin E 1.04mg 35.17mg Sunflower seed
Vitamin C 0mg 1.4mg Sunflower seed
Vitamin B1 0.108mg 1.48mg Sunflower seed
Vitamin B2 0.18mg 0.355mg Sunflower seed
Vitamin B3 1.143mg 8.335mg Sunflower seed
Vitamin B5 1.399mg 1.13mg Black pepper
Vitamin B6 0.291mg 1.345mg Sunflower seed
Folate 17µg 227µg Sunflower seed
Vitamin K 163.7µg 0µg Black pepper
Tryptophan 0.058mg 0.348mg Sunflower seed
Threonine 0.244mg 0.928mg Sunflower seed
Isoleucine 0.366mg 1.139mg Sunflower seed
Leucine 1.014mg 1.659mg Sunflower seed
Lysine 0.244mg 0.937mg Sunflower seed
Methionine 0.096mg 0.494mg Sunflower seed
Phenylalanine 0.446mg 1.169mg Sunflower seed
Valine 0.547mg 1.315mg Sunflower seed
Histidine 0.159mg 0.632mg Sunflower seed
Saturated Fat 1.392g 4.455g Black pepper
Omega-3 - EPA 0g 0.014g Sunflower seed
Monounsaturated Fat 0.739g 18.528g Sunflower seed
Polyunsaturated fat 0.998g 23.137g Sunflower seed
Omega-3 - ALA 0.152g Black pepper
